What I want is to open start.swf, have it embed moviecontainer.swf which has a FLV playback object that loads in the movie.flv.
When I check my moviecontainer.swf, it runs properly. But when I use start.swf it loads moviecontainer.swf (because I can see it has the background and all) but the movie won't play (and I think the buttons don't work anymore)
I have saved both .swfs with the "Local files only" option. I have no idea what the problem can be, as I said, I'm no Flash pro and I have no experience as to say "oh it looks like we got that xyz problem.."
This should be a path issue:
When you set the url for the FLV playback component from within the movie container and run it, the application's working directory is assets
, and the movie's relative path is flv/movie.flv
.
When you import the container into your start.swf, the work path has changed to the top directory, and the url should now be assets/flv/movie.flv
.
